Govt Plans to Re-Introduce Technical Subjects in Secondary Schools

In a bid to equip students with vocational and entrepreneurship skills for socio-economic growth, government through the ministry of Education Science and Technology has re-introduced technical subjects in Secondary schools.

Director of Administration at ministry of education Hillary Namainja said the initiative is aimed at preparing secondary school students to be independent after school.

Namainja added that as the country is moving students should not be given the mentality of getting white collar jobs alone citing there is a need to impart the entrepreneurship spirit in them.

According to Namainja, at least 12 schools are yet to benefit from the initiative.

“We have about 12 secondary schools in the country, that provide technical subjects, in the past we used to have such subjects but because of passage of time most of the equipment deteriorated,” said Namainja.

In his remarks, head teacher for Mzuzu Government Secondary School, Vincent Mudolo said they are steady and ready to start teaching the subjects since the school has qualified teachers to teach such subjects.
